Big changes with VRBO's cancellation policy and Premier Host Program* If the host cancels a booking 48 hours before the stay, they will be charged 50% of gross booking value — that’s the most harsh penalty. If it is canceled between 30 days to 48 hours prior, the penalty is 25%; prior to 30 days, the penalty is 10% with a minimum of $50. * Hosts can get a waiver for unavoidable cancellations, such as those attributable to natural disasters. Vrbo confirmed that, for now, only hosts in the U.S. will face the penalties. * Updates to eligibility requirements for the Premier Host program will start January 2024. The new requirements aim to make the program more exclusive, by only admitting hosts with an average overall rating of 4.4+, those whose initiated cancellation rate is less than 1%, and those whose booking acceptance rates are 95% or higher.

Booking.com has a hard time delivering payouts to vacation rental hosts* European hosts are hardest hit * This is on top of years of broken promises and instability with their payment infrastructure + They have had tons of technical difficulties, communication fails * They sent this message to hosts this summer… “Payout for reservation check-outs between 28 June – 19 July will be processed by 24th July 2023 in one consolidated payment. Regular payout schedule is expected to resume by 27th July 2023.”“Payout for reservation check-outs between 28 June – 19 July will be processed by 24th July 2023 in one consolidated payment. Regular payout schedule is expected to resume by 27th July 2023.” * Hosts actually voiced their concern because ON the payment date - no payment to be found - then Booking changed their tune and said ok - new date August 4 * A lot of hosts have thousands of dollars stuck in Booking’s financial system. While expenses have to be paid TODAY, booking is making hosts wait until tomorrow… * A huge issue here is that booking.com is not really doing much to fix this - not really showing responsibility and this creates more distrust - hosts who are impacted, do not feel they can rely on the platform * Is booking.com insolvent? Well no, they have a diversified company - this is more of an issue with their financial infrastructure - this is mainly a tech issue more so than a finance one. * Comparison to other platforms: Airbnb and VRBO have generally done better with their payout records * Connect with Me: john@vacationhomehelp.com * This episode is brought to you by the Vacation Rentals with John Newsletter my very own email newsletter every Friday that features 4 bullet points highlighting cool things I found this week in the short term rental world including apps, books, tech, new hacks, tricks, articles, and other weird but interesting short term rental stuff of value that I stumbled upon. Seasonality & Pricing on Airbnb & VRBO: A practical approach to optimize for seasonal demand and rake in profits.
Seasonality is dependent on your market
Florida, which I am most familiar with, has the following seasonality by rule of thumb
season - Christmas, Passover, Easter, 4th of July, Thanksgiving Holiday, Spring
Break are Peak - High season is summer when everyone is on summer vacation - Normal demand is the rest of the year with some exceptions... + Events do impact demand though, think for example, the Superbowl is coming into town, or Mardi Gras in New Orleans! That would be a reason to hike rates to match demand + Action steps: Peak season can be 2-3x your base rate, check comps. Some smart pricers block their busiest days until 90 days prior. While risky, you can charge as much as a 35% premium (or more) because there will be a lack of desirable inventory closer to the date. Again this is in some markets + If you are empty 45 days out, lower prices, if you are empty 2 weeks out, consider lowering prices if it makes sense for your finances to get booked. Remember do not price too low though, or you can attract a party crowd. + Do comparable analysis frequently (as much as once a month) to stay on top of trends. Is superhost status worth it in 2022?
What is superhost status ○ The "superhost" designation on Airbnb is a sign that an Airbnb host has gotten
consistently good reviews over at least a year of hosting. Airbnb checks the status of hosts four times a year to ensure that a superhost badge is still relevant for each host.
○ - Host a minimum of 10 stays in a year ○ - Respond to guests quickly and maintain a 90% response rate or higher ○ - Have at least 80% 5-star reviews ○ - Honor confirmed reservations (meaning hosts should rarely cancel)

Do not forget this simple way to get direct bookings (saving you thousands in the process) - friends, family, and casual conversation! Always be your vacation rental's best cheerleader...
An example of this so often overlooked is letting your friends and family know you have an awesome place, offering them the ‘friend’ discount to their friends as well. Ask them to share it. One host I know secured 12 bookings this way. 4 from friends, each friend told a friend, and so on. Best of all, no service fees so the guest won, host won, everyone won
Every conversation you have about vacation, bring your place up in a non-braggy way. Not like, I have a place in the Hamptons...no just like ‘I love going to my vacation rental in Florida its a great way to unplug and be with my family, I started renting it to others and they feel the same...” drop this in conversation, always be selling...
Think outside of the box. Events, sports teams, conventions...do not let airbnb do the selling for you or they will take a fee off of ALL of your business.
Promote your business to the realtors you know and offer them a commission. You may think this is the same as Airbnb, but its not...you can drastically lower what you pay in service fees if you think of it in terms of wallet share. If you pay a realtor $250 for referring a client of theirs to stay with you its better than the same booking paying out $750 to airbnb...best of all once you have a couple great real estate pros that you know they will do the selling for you. Make sure you give them the tools to help you do this...
All in all, the actionable advice is to spread the word the old fashioned way!

In the Disney World market (Osceola County - Kissimmee, FL) it is taxable and their tax office literature states you must pay tax on airbnb's platform fee. Does not sound fair does it? However, you must do due diligence to see if your local tax office will charge you on airbnb's platform fee as well or you can end up in thousands of dollars in penalties during an audit. When we say taxable, we are referring to lodging tax, occupancy tax, bed tax for vacation rentals.

John and Tim discuss the recent Airbnb Cancellation Policy Update.
Key Highlights:
Effective August 22, 2022.
Airbnb will impose fees subject to a minimum cancellation fee of $50 USD and a maximum cancellation fee of $1,000 USD. The fee is based on the reservation amount and when the reservation is canceled:
When calculating cancellation fees, the reservation amount includes the base rate, cleaning fee, and any pet fees, but excludes taxes and guest fees. If the calculated cancellation fee is less than $50 USD, it will be adjusted up to $50 USD, and if the calculated fee is more than $1,000 USD, it will be adjusted down to $1,000 USD.

Service animals are different from Emotional Support Animals. Both are different from pets. Find out what you need to know about hosting our furry, four-legged friends!
Here are the highlights:
See Airbnb's Accessibility Policy here:
https://www.airbnb.com/help/article/1869/accessibility-policy
Two questions you are legally allowed to ask regarding service animals:
(1) is the dog a service animal required because of a disability? and (2) what work or task has the dog been trained to perform?
Please note, we highly recommend being accommodating and hosting service animals - it is the right thing to do!
Note: Federal Law does not require you to host in a single family dwelling a service animal, but you will be violating terms and conditions you agreed to when you signed up to use the OTA (Airbnb, VRBO) and can be suspended if you take this stance.

Today on the Vacation Home Help Podcast we are going to talk about how to price your place on Airbnb, VRBO, and other platforms. Pricing your place is both an art and a science. How you price will make or break your investment. Price too high? You will scare away prospective guests. Too low, lots of occupancy but you will fall short of your potential and you will experience more wear and tear on your property.
Pricing your place is a 5-stage process:
Researching your local competition and benchmarking
Moving away from one-size-fits-all pricing and setting a strategy,
Increasing prices for demand and seasonality
Promotions and discounts to attract guests
Adding extra fees (cleaning fee)
